Bovada Poker
Bovada Poker remains one of the highest-traffic destinations for North American card players operating on the shared PaiWangLuo network. Its defining feature is the anonymous seating model, which conceals screen names and blocks third-party heads-up displays from tracking historical hands across sessions. This design balances the field between casual participants and experienced multi-tablers. The platform provides consistent liquidity across micro to mid-stakes No-Limit Texas Hold'em and Pot-Limit Omaha tables, alongside high-volume multi-table tournament series. Cashier mechanics strongly favor digital assets such as Bitcoin, Ethereum, and Litecoin, which avoid the high processing surcharges and slower turnaround times associated with credit cards and bank checks. Because Bovada operates under an offshore regulatory model rather than local state licensing, participants must weigh table liquidity against the absence of domestic consumer protections.
pokerstars ee
PokerStars EE provides a dedicated, regulated portal for players located in Estonia, operated under Flutter Entertainment group standards with licensing from the Estonian Tax and Customs Board. The primary draw of the platform remains its poker network, which connects local participants to expansive global tournament schedules and cash game pools. Beyond poker, the site maintains a full online casino suite and an integrated sportsbook.
While the software reliability and table traffic rank among the strongest in the market, players must navigate rigorous local identity checks, standard promotional wagering structures, and automated support queues.
